Cyclone Separators Sales Market Outlook

The global cyclone separators market is projected to reach a valuation of approximately $3.5 billion by 2035,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.8%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2035. This growth trajectory is largely driven by the increasing demand for efficient separation techniques across various industries, including oil and gas, power generation, and food and beverage, which require high-performance equipment to enhance operation reliability and reduce downtime. Furthermore, the growing awareness about air pollution control and the implementation of stringent environmental regulations have led industries to invest in effective air and gas treatment solutions, thus providing an impetus to the cyclone separators market. Additionally, advancements in material technology and design innovations are making cyclone separators more efficient and cost-effective, which further fuels market growth.

By Product Type

Reverse-Flow Cyclone Separators:

Reverse-flow cyclone separators are designed to efficiently separate particles from a gas stream by creating a high-velocity vortex. This type of separator performs exceptionally well in applications involving high dust loads and is often used in industries such as mining and power generation. The unique design allows for effective particle separation, resulting in minimal pressure drop and enhanced system efficiency. As industries increasingly focus on optimizing resource recovery and minimizing waste, the demand for reverse-flow cyclone separators is steadily rising, contributing to their significant share in the overall market.

Tangential Cyclone Separators:

Tangential cyclone separators work by introducing the feed stream tangentially, which induces a swirling motion crucial for effective separation of particles. This design is prevalent in industries dealing with fine particles and is particularly effective in applications within the chemical sector. The ability of tangential cyclone separators to separate particles with high precision has made them a preferred choice for industries requiring stringent separation processes. As manufacturers continue to optimize operational efficiency, the demand for these separators is anticipated to grow significantly in the coming years.

Axial Cyclone Separators:

Axial cyclone separators are characterized by their unique axial flow design, allowing for effective separation of gas-solid mixtures. These separators are primarily utilized in applications where low pressure drop and high collection efficiency are critical, such as in the food and beverage and pharmaceutical industries. The design facilitates a more streamlined flow of materials, which enhances overall operational efficiency. As industries strive to maintain compliance with health and safety regulations while maximizing output, the demand for axial cyclone separators is projected to increase, reflecting their vital role in the market.

Twin Cyclone Separators:

Twin cyclone separators are designed to handle larger volumes of particles and are suitable for demanding applications across various industries. Their dual design allows for greater separation efficiency, making them ideal for heavy-duty operations such as mining and construction. The capacity to manage larger dust loads while maintaining optimal operational efficiency positions twin cyclone separators as a valuable asset for manufacturers looking to enhance productivity. The growing industrial activities in emerging markets are expected to drive the demand for twin cyclone separators in the foreseeable future.

Multicyclone Separators:

Multicyclone separators utilize multiple cylindrical cyclone elements to achieve higher separation efficiencies, particularly for fine particles. They are commonly employed in applications requiring precise separation, such as in the oil and gas sector and power generation. This type of separator is advantageous due to its compact design, which allows for the integration of multiple units into a single system, thereby enhancing space efficiency. As industries continue to expand and evolve, the need for multicyclone separators is expected to rise, driven by their versatility and efficiency across various applications.

By Application

Oil and Gas:

The oil and gas industry significantly relies on cyclone separators for efficient separation of solid particles from gas streams during extraction and refining processes. This application is critical as it directly impacts the quality of the output products and operational efficiency. With the continuous exploration and production activities in the sector, the demand for advanced cyclone separators is increasing. These systems help in maintaining the integrity of the processes by minimizing the risk of equipment fouling and downtime, which is vital for maximizing production levels in a highly competitive environment.

Power Generation:

Cyclone separators play a pivotal role in power generation, particularly in coal-fired plants where they separate fly ash from flue gas. This process not only enhances the efficiency of energy production but also helps in meeting stringent environmental regulations regarding emissions. As the global focus shifts towards sustainable energy sources and cleaner technologies, power generation facilities are increasingly adopting cyclone separators to optimize their operations. The growing investments in renewable energy projects further underline the importance of efficient separation technologies in this sector.

Chemical:

In the chemical industry, cyclone separators are utilized to remove particulates from gases and liquids, ensuring product purity and compliance with environmental standards. The ability to handle a wide range of process conditions makes cyclone separators essential for various chemical production processes. As the industry faces pressures to reduce emissions and improve process efficiency, the adoption of cyclone separators is expected to rise. Their role in enhancing product quality while also contributing to cost reductions is driving their demand in the chemical sector.

Mining:

Cyclone separators are extensively used in the mining industry for the separation of valuable minerals from gangue material. The ability to separate particles based on size and density is crucial in maximizing resource recovery. As mining operations become more mechanized, the demand for efficient separation technologies such as cyclone separators is increasing. The growing focus on sustainable mining practices is also propelling the adoption of cyclone separators, as they help reduce waste and improve the overall environmental footprint of mining operations.

Food and Beverage:

The food and beverage sector utilizes cyclone separators to ensure product safety and quality by removing contaminants from processing streams. This application is vital for maintaining hygiene and compliance with food safety regulations. As consumer awareness regarding food quality rises, manufacturers are increasingly investing in advanced separation technologies to improve their processes. The need for efficient cyclone separators that can handle varying flow rates and particle sizes is expected to enhance their market presence in the food and beverage industry.

By Material Type

Metallic Cyclone Separators:

Metallic cyclone separators are widely used due to their durability and resistance to high temperatures and corrosive environments. These separators are particularly effective in harsh industrial settings such as oil and gas and mining, where they are exposed to abrasive particles and extreme operating conditions. The longevity and reliability of metallic separators make them a preferred choice for manufacturers looking to minimize maintenance and replacement costs. As industries continue to prioritize operational efficiency and equipment reliability, the demand for metallic cyclone separators is expected to remain strong.

Non-metallic Cyclone Separators:

Non-metallic cyclone separators, often made from polymers or composites, are gaining traction due to their lightweight properties, corrosion resistance, and ease of fabrication. These separators are particularly suitable for applications in the food and beverage industry, where hygienic conditions are paramount. The ability of non-metallic separators to provide effective separation without the risk of contamination makes them an attractive option for manufacturers. As industries increasingly focus on sustainability and reducing their environmental footprint, the adoption of non-metallic cyclone separators is likely to grow.

Threats

Despite the promising outlook for the cyclone separators market, there are several threats that could pose challenges to its growth. One notable threat is the increasing competition from alternative separation technologies, such as electrostatic precipitators and bag filters, which may offer similar or improved performance characteristics. As industries continuously seek enhancements in efficiency and cost-effectiveness, the adoption of these alternative technologies could impact the demand for traditional cyclone separators. Additionally, fluctuations in raw material prices, particularly for metallic cyclone separators, can affect production costs and, consequently, pricing strategies for manufacturers. This may create volatility in market dynamics and impact profit margins.

Another significant threat is the potential regulatory changes concerning environmental standards and emissions controls. While stringent regulations have generally driven demand for cyclone separators, any changes in government policies or shifts in industry regulations could alter the requirement for specific separation technologies. Manufacturers must remain adaptable and responsive to evolving regulations to maintain their market positions. Furthermore, global economic uncertainties, such as trade tensions or economic downturns, can lead to reduced investments in industrial infrastructure, which could hinder the growth of the cyclone separators market.
